How they compare
Zimbabwe currently reports 86.0% against 85.1% in Sao Tome and Principe, a difference of 0.9%.
The two have swapped places 3 times across 8 shared years of data; in 1984 it was Sao Tome and Principe ahead.
Sao Tome and Principe ranks 142nd and Zimbabwe ranks 139th of 198 countries.
Across the 4 decades both report, Sao Tome and Principe averaged higher in 1 and Zimbabwe in 3.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Sao Tome and Principe | Zimbabwe |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1980s | 107.5% | 83.5% | 24.0% | Sao Tome and Principe |
| 1990s | 44.5% | 85.8% | 41.3% | Zimbabwe |
| 2000s | 55.3% | 94.5% | 39.2% | Zimbabwe |
| 2010s | 87.2% | 87.5% | 0.3% | Zimbabwe |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
